Treatment Techniques for Resolution
Even with hurdles, therapy sessions can substantially boost your approach to managing disputes. Here's where methods such as active listening come into play. It extends past merely listening to copyright, but grasping the emotions behind them. As your partner talks, pay attention to their sentiments, rather than your reply. Empathy building, another crucial ability, involves understanding your partner's viewpoint, truly comprehending their point of view. This doesn't mean you must agree, but accepting their perspective can strengthen bonds.

Reviving Romance and Intimacy in Relationships
If you discover that the chemistry in your relationship has dimmed, rest assured you're not alone. Many couples encounter phases of decreased affection. Reigniting love and affection in your relationship typically requires recognizing each other's love languages and developing emotional intimacy. Love languages demonstrate how we prefer to receive love and appreciation, whether through loving copyright, thoughtful gestures, or time together. Learning your partner's love language can help restore the intimacy you used to have. Emotional intimacy, the capacity to express your deepest thoughts and feelings, acts as another essential aspect of strengthening your relationship. It's about vulnerability, faith, and mutual respect. Couples therapy offers the resources and direction to help you explore these aspects, strengthening your bond and revitalizing your love.

Therapeutic Methods Examined
Expanding upon the comprehension of what couples therapy is, you may be interested in what takes place during the sessions. It's a process that involves several therapeutic techniques. Emotion regulation is an important method. The goal is helping you and your partner handle and address emotional reactions constructively. This doesn't mean repressing feelings, but communicating them in ways that promote understanding and closeness.
One more technique is strengthening emotional bonds. This could involve practical tasks or dialogues aimed at improve emotional connection, trust, and mutual respect. You might explore common experiences, dreams, or recollections. The focus is on rekindling the connection and strengthening your relationship. Don't forget, therapy doesn't provide instant solutions. It's a journey, and these techniques are tools to help you navigate it.

Will Insurance Cover My Couples Therapy Sessions?
Insurance coverage for couples therapy isn't guaranteed, so you'll need to verify with your insurance company. Each policy has different terms, so you'll want to verify your exact benefits. Look into various payment possibilities to ensure therapy remains affordable while investing in your partnership.
What is the Typical Duration of a Therapy Session?
You may have questions regarding session duration in therapy. Most commonly, sessions last around 45 to 60 minutes. Nevertheless, the length and frequency of sessions can vary based on your unique requirements and the therapist's approach. It's tailored to your needs.
